We stayed from a Thursday night until Sunday morning during our Seattle get-away. The location was perfect for walking to the Seattle center to enjoy attractions there. Plus, you could catch the monorail to get to downtown Seattle.
The hotel seemed old and worn. Stained carpet, evidence of construction work, very low entrance to underground parking making it impossible for our SUV to park there. We were able to park at the "Element" hotel next door, which had an 8 foot vehicle entrance. They even gave us a discount with a free day of parking. (Will probably stay there next time) Also, the breakfast prices were high, so the only time we ate breakfast was because the desk clerk gave us a complimentary coupon.
